DENVER – University of Denver fifth-year guard Tommy Bruner has been named the Summit League Male Athlete of the Month for December, the league office announced on Thursday. Bruner earned the award for the second-consecutive month to start the season as he continues to lead the country in both scoring (25.2) and free-throws made (115).
Bruner averaged 25.4 points in the month of December to go with 5.4 assists and 2.4 rebounds per game. The Denver guard shot 57-68 from the free-throw line, finishing from the stripe at an 83.8% clip.
The South Carolina native had 20+ points in five of seven games in the month, including 28 in Denver's match-up in Fort Collins at nationally ranked Colorado State. Bruner had a career-high 37 points in a single-digit Denver win on December 18. In addition to his scoring, Bruner distributed the basketball well, finishing with a career-high eight assists three different times in the month.
While leading the country in scoring and free-throw shooting, Bruner is also 56th in the country in assists (67), second in field goals made (125) and 42nd in three-pointers made (39).
Bruner's back-to-back awards joins Denver men's soccer's Oje Ofunrein and Isaac Nehme, giving Denver the male athlete of the month in all four months in this athletic calendar, the first time that has been accomplished by a school in the Summit League since South Dakota in 2016-17.
